IEC 61857-22:2008 is a technical reference for evaluating the thermal performance of an encapsulated-coil model within a wire-wound electrical insulation system (EIS). It is relevant where engineers need a documented basis for assessing insulation behavior under heat stress, especially during design review, verification activities, and conformity assessment. As a primary compliance reference, IEC 61857-22:2008 supports technical evaluation of insulation systems used in electrical equipment where thermal endurance is a key part of operational reliability and risk management.

Purpose of IEC 61857-22:2008

The purpose of IEC 61857-22:2008 is to define specific requirements for thermal evaluation using an encapsulated-coil model tied to a wire-wound EIS. In practice, this helps laboratories and engineering teams apply a structured method for documented evaluation of insulation performance under elevated temperature conditions. The title indicates a focused procedure rather than a broad product specification, making it useful for technical assessment, product evaluation, and validation of insulation-system behavior during development or qualification work.
